Astana's Kenesary Khan Monument Reinstalled After Restoration Astana, Kazakhstan – The monument to Kenesary Khan, a significant historical figure in Kazakhstan, has been reinstalled in Astana after undergoing restoration work. The monument's temporary removal last year sparked online speculation and debate. Yerlan Karin, the State Councilor of Kazakhstan, confirmed the reinstallation in a social media post. He stated, "Last year, when the monument was removed for repairs, there was a lot of discussion online. Despite repeated explanations, unconfirmed information was spread. In reality, the monument needed repairs, and now it's even taller." The reinstallation marks the end of the restoration process and silences the rumors surrounding the monument's fate.
